I asked about LASIK but my corneas are too thin. Of the two alternatives, ICL seemed better (faster recovery, reversible, no dryness) but my insurance would only cover PRK. It was easy to schedule a consultation and easy to schedule and reschedule the actual procedure--they are quick to respond to calls and emails. The office staff move you along quickly and efficiently. Some staff were actually very friendly but others seemed more interested in moving things along. There were also quite a lot of different steps to take and information to absorb and it all could have been better/more centrally organized and provided at the beginning.The day of the procedure is a little overwhelming with final testing, instructions, and questions. They will offer you Xanax and I recommend you take it. The procedure is fast and doesn't hurt but there is a lot of motion, sensation, and a busy room of people calling out jargon and countdowns around you. I unfortunately didn't get enough time for the Xanax to kick in for the procedure, but it did help me nap when I got home. After the procedure I experienced burning and sensitivity and I kept my sunglasses on inside with the blinds down for four days. I had to use lubricating drops for a few months. The blurriness was disorienting and it fluctuated from day to day--several weeks after surgery I was still increasing the font size on my phone for readability. But two months out my vision reached 20/15 (better than average).Overall, I highly recommend Boston Vision in Brookline.
